The Japan Plant Factory market is experiencing significant growth driven by factors such as rising demand for high-quality, pesticide-free crops, limited arable land availability, and increasing focus on sustainable agricultural practices. Plant factories in Japan utilize advanced technologies including hydroponics, LED lighting, and automated systems to optimize plant growth and productivity. The market is characterized by a strong emphasis on research and development to enhance crop yields and quality while reducing environmental impact. Key players in the Japan Plant Factory market include Spread Co. Ltd., Mirai Co. Ltd., and Fujitsu Ltd. In the Japan Plant Factory Market, some of the key challenges include high initial setup costs, limited availability of skilled labor for plant factory operations, strict regulations on agriculture and food production, and competition from traditional outdoor farming methods. The high costs associated with setting up a plant factory, including expenses for equipment, technology, and energy usage, can be a barrier for many potential investors. Additionally, finding and retaining skilled workers with expertise in indoor farming techniques and technology can be a challenge in Japan`s competitive labor market. The stringent regulations on agriculture and food production in Japan also pose challenges for plant factories in terms of compliance and operational flexibility. Finally, traditional outdoor farming methods remain prevalent in Japan, leading to competition for market share and consumer preference.

In Japan, government policies related to the plant factory market aim to promote sustainable agriculture and food security. The government has introduced initiatives such as the Agriculture, Forestry and Fisheries Research Council`s Plant Factory Promotion Project, which supports research and development in plant factories to enhance productivity and reduce environmental impact. Additionally, subsidies and tax incentives are provided to encourage businesses to invest in plant factory technologies. These policies align with Japan`s goal of increasing domestic food production while minimizing resource usage and ensuring food safety.
